Release 1.2.1
Introduction
Modbus agent release 1.2.1 is an agent service release.
IDP terminals using this release must be running IDP firmware v5.0.13 or higher, and SG-7100
terminals must be running firmware v1.0.0 or higher. `
New Features
 Periodically reads Modbus parameters from slaves over RS-232/RS-485/TCP.
 Supports multiple reads within a single message.
 Decodes read parameters and reports them in Lua events and optionally in properties.
 On-demand read and decode from Modbus parameters over-the-air and using Lua
functions.
 On-demand write to Modbus parameters over-the-air and using Lua functions.
 Support for up to 1000 registers and 255 slaves.
 Support for IDP terminals and SG-7100.

Upgrade Instructions for Existing Customers
SkyWave IDP terminal customers with existing terminals must use the Console application,
which is found in the IDP Toolkit, to upgrade the application according to the instructions below.

Loading or Upgrading the Package File


For IDP Terminals:
1. Log in to https://support.skywave.com and download:
 The latest version of the IDP Toolkit (IsatData Pro category)
 The latest agent package file (Agent Services Software category)
2. Uninstall any previously installed versions of the IDP Toolkit.
3. Install the latest version of the IDP Toolkit.
4. Start Console, which is found in the IDP Toolkit.
5. Click File > Connect to connect to the serial port on the terminal. Make sure that the
terminal’s baud rate is set to 9600.
The Lua Services Framework loads and brings you to the shell prompt.
6. Click File > Load Package.
7. Browse for and select the latest agent .idppkg package file (modbus-Rel-v1_2_1.idppkg),
and then click Open.
After the upload completes, Console returns to the Lua Services Framework.

For SG-7100 Terminals:


1. Log in to https://support.skywave.com and download the latest agent package file (Agent
Services Software category).
2. Start WinSCP.
3. In the Host Name field, enter the terminal's IP address and connect to the terminal using
the root or admin credentials.
4. Click Login and wait for the connection to complete.
5. In the SG-7100 folders in the right pane of the WinSCP window, navigate to
/LSF_ADMIN/packages.
6. In the left pane, navigate to and select the agent .idppkg package file that you downloaded
(modbus-Rel-v1_2_1.idppkg).
7. Click Upload to transfer the file to the SG-7100, and wait for the package file transfer to
complete.
8. Restart the LSF. Refer to T302 for detailed instructions.
